Zhengchao An 507447da12 fix(restore): reject SELECT restore and keep typed S3 errors (#7113)
* fix(restore): reject SELECT restore and keep typed S3 errors

RestoreObject accepted `Type=SELECT` requests, but the restore path can
only write the retrieved bytes back to the source key: `put_restore_opts`
built SELECT output options and `restore_transitioned_object` then PUT
them over the source bucket/object. On an unversioned bucket that dropped
`x-amz-restore`, user metadata and tags from the live object; on a
versioned bucket it published a bogus latest version. Nothing was ever
written to `OutputLocation.S3`, yet the response still carried a
fabricated `x-amz-restore-output-path`.

Reject SELECT at the API boundary with a typed NotImplemented, before any
guard or metadata write, and fail closed in `put_restore_opts` as the
backstop for any other caller.

Every other RestoreObject failure was collapsed into a `Custom` error
code, which serializes as a generic retryable 500: a missing key or
version, a malformed version-id, an object that was never transitioned,
an illegal `Days`, and authorization or storage failures all looked the
same to a client. Map them to their S3 identities instead — NoSuchKey,
NoSuchVersion, InvalidArgument, InvalidObjectState, InvalidRequest,
MalformedXML — by preserving `StorageError` through `post_restore_opts`
and letting `ApiError` do the mapping. The intentional 409
RestoreAlreadyInProgress and 503 SlowDown behaviour is unchanged, and
request validation now runs before any lock is taken.

唐小鸭 53cabe9274 fix(replication): send an integrity header on Object Lock PUTs (#7097)
* fix(replication): send an integrity header on Object Lock replication PUTs

AWS S3, MinIO and most compatible targets reject a PutObject that carries
x-amz-object-lock-* headers unless it also carries Content-MD5 or an
x-amz-checksum-* header. Since rustfs#6895 the replication client sends
plain signed payloads with no SDK checksum, so every replicated object
with a retention period or legal hold failed against such targets.

TargetClient::put_object now decides per request through the pure
rustfs_replication::object_lock_put_integrity: a plaintext single-part
object whose source ETag is its MD5 gets Content-MD5 derived from the
ETag (no body pass, framing unchanged); a multipart-layout ETag, managed
SSE or SSE-C passthrough falls back to an SDK CRC32; a forwarded source
checksum or an unlocked PUT is left alone.

The outbound target matrix flips its two KnownFailing(rustfs#7082) cells
to Completed and every Completed cell now asserts that a locked
PutObject carried an integrity header.

Fixes rustfs#7082.

唐小鸭 af896dc427 test(ecstore): remove host and load dependencies from flaky suites (#7008)
* test(ecstore): retain final decommission capacity snapshot override

take_decommission_capacity_info_override_for_test used to pop the queue
to exhaustion, after which get_decommission_all_pool_capacity_infos
silently fell back to the host's real statfs numbers. Any new sampling
point added to the decommission start paths re-introduced that host
dependency and broke tests on some dev machines (#6989 patched one
instance by topping up snapshot counts, but the coupling remained).

Keep the final queued snapshot and replay it for every subsequent
sample so tests always observe injected capacity once an override is
installed. All existing injection patterns (single snapshot, repeated
identical snapshots, decreasing sequences ending at the post-operation
state) keep their semantics.

* test(ci): serialize load-sensitive heal and cache-generation tests

Under a heavily parallel nextest run (~792 ecstore tests), two tests of
set_disk::ops::heal::heal_result_report_tests failed nondeterministically
per round (different members each time; all 29 pass standalone). Every
test in the module builds a TempDir-backed 4-disk hermetic erasure set
and drives MiB-scale writes plus deep-scan heal: under load a single
disk's IO can fail while write quorum still holds, flipping per-disk
readback and aggregate-outcome assertions. The module's #[serial]
markers do not serialize across nextest's process-per-test boundary.

Verification also caught complete_multipart_generation_retires_cached_snapshot
failing once under the same load; it and its object.rs sibling carry
#[serial(metadata_cache_invalidation_probe)] and assert
get_object_metadata_cache generation semantics - the same shape that
forced the transition matrix tests into the serial group.

Add both families to the ecstore-serial-flaky test-group in the default
and ci profiles. Preventive serialization only, no retries. Three full
parallel rounds after the change: 792/792 passed each round.

唐小鸭 1dcdfe4817 build(make): resolve a Python 3.11+ interpreter for guard scripts (#7004)
scripts/check_test_wiring.py and scripts/check_security_coverage.py import
tomllib, which landed in Python 3.11. macOS ships /usr/bin/python3 at 3.9, so
`make pre-commit` failed on a clean machine with `ModuleNotFoundError: No
module named 'tomllib'` in test-wiring-check, even though the checkers
themselves are fine.

Add scripts/python_bin.sh, which resolves an interpreter (explicit
RUSTFS_PYTHON, then python3.14..3.11/python3/python on PATH, then a
`uv run --python 3.12 --no-project` fallback) and execs it, failing with the
concrete remediation when nothing usable exists. Route the Make call sites
through RUSTFS_PYTHON_BIN. CI workflows keep calling python3 directly because
their runners already provide 3.11+.

Zhengchao An cf362282f0 fix(test): serialize transition matrix tests under nextest (#6874)
The transition_matrix_tests use #[serial_test::serial] which has no
effect under nextest (each test runs in a separate process). When running
alongside thousands of other ecstore tests, the shared metadata cache
generation counter can race, causing intermittent 'metadata read should
publish the generation under test' panics.

Add both tests to the ecstore-serial-flaky test group in both default
and ci nextest profiles so they run single-threaded.

Zhengchao An 4f4d268155 ci: ratchet ecstore ::other(format!) error construction shrink-only (#6614)
Backlog#1845 step 2. reduce_errs buckets per-disk errors by equality, and Io equality compares the rendered message, so an other(format!(..)) error embedding per-disk detail makes N same-cause failures count as N distinct errors during quorum aggregation. The census that opened the issue counted 1,609 such sites; the production count in crates/ecstore/src is 657 today and was still growing.

Freeze it: scripts/check_error_other_format_ratchet.sh counts ::other(format! sites per file (trailing #[cfg(test)] modules excluded) against a shrink-only per-file baseline, failing on any growth and on stale entries after a shrink, following the layer-dependency-baseline model. Wired into make pre-commit / pre-pr / dev-check and the CI Quick Checks job.
